ICAN’s Inclusive Halloween Festival Returns to Torrance October 25
Free community event celebrates inclusion with games, shows, and fun for all ages
Torrance, CA, ICAN California Abilities Network (ICAN) is thrilled to announce the return of its annual Halloween Festival on Saturday, October 25, 2025, from 12 PM to 4 PM at SCROC (2300 Crenshaw Blvd., Torrance, CA 90501)
This free, family-friendly event invites individuals with disabilities, their families, and the community to celebrate the Halloween season in an inclusive and accessible environment. Guests can expect an afternoon filled with festive games, live shows, crafts, jumpers, and more.
“This festival is one of our favorite days of the year,” said Scott Elliott, Executive Director of ICAN. “It’s a day where everyone, regardless of ability, gets to experience the fun, laughter, and connection that make our community so special.”
In addition to the main attractions, guests will enjoy a magician, petting zoo, music, food vendors, bracelet making, LEGO building, coloring stations, and more. Costumes are encouraged (but not required).

About ICAN California Abilities Network
IICAN is a nonprofit organization that provides quality employment, life skills, and social programs for Southern California’s adults with intellectual & developmental disabilities. We have locations in Torrance, Long Beach, and Redondo Beach, California.
